LWN.net Logo

Yay for open source drivers

Yay for open source drivers

Posted Jul 24, 2012 17:30 UTC (Tue) by Cyberax (✭ supporter ✭, #52523)
In reply to: Yay for open source drivers by drag
Parent article: Romanick: The zombies cometh...

That's wrong. Fglrx _is_ faster because it's much MUCH more sophisticated than open source drivers. Oh, and fglrx also supports OpenGL 4.x, while Mesa is still stuck at OpenGL 3.0 (it might get to OpenGL 3.3 by the end of the year).

Phoronix regularly compares fglrx against the open source drivers. Fglrx almost always wins on rather generic benchmarks.


(Log in to post comments)

Yay for open source drivers

Posted Jul 24, 2012 17:52 UTC (Tue) by drag (subscriber, #31333) [Link]

No it's right because I've actually used it and compared it on my own machine.

Not only did fglrx crash more often, was a pain in the ass to install, it broke my desktop, and performance of starcraft in wine was miserable. Graphic glitches and poor performance. OSS worked much better.

IMHO; if you are planning on running proprietary drivers to get good performance you are a moron if you buy AMD.

I run AMD because I want open source drivers and something that is faster then Intel.

Yay for open source drivers

Posted Jul 24, 2012 19:53 UTC (Tue) by Cyberax (✭ supporter ✭, #52523) [Link]

I actually worked with a company running fglrx on Linux desktops. They had (and still have) a constant stream of complaints about bugs and glitches and general instability.

Yet they persist because OpenSource drivers are not yet up to speed with the proprietary ones. It's not uncommon to have 2-10 times speed difference between them.

Yay for open source drivers

Posted Jul 24, 2012 20:08 UTC (Tue) by drag (subscriber, #31333) [Link]

Yeah. Unfortunately it's a bad situation.

If it was up to me AMD would drop catalyst altogether and pool their effort into the OSS drivers.

But I understand that isn't going to happen because they need to maintain competitive performance with Nvidia for the people that use it on professional graphical workstations. It simply will take too long for OSS drivers to catch up.

Yay for open source drivers

Posted Jul 27, 2012 13:41 UTC (Fri) by Wol (guest, #4433) [Link]

AMD should licence all their code in the drivers as BSD or GPL or whatever, and then sort out with their suppliers to supply the drivers under NDA.

I would have thought there would be a decent number of developers - either true open source guys, or games company guys like here, who would be prepared to sign the NDA and then (because the AMD code wouldn't be covered by the NDA) leak code or design into the Open Source drivers.

And just in case anyone misunderstands me, what I'm suggesting is perfectly legit - developers can get hold of the driver source under NDA (to protect AMD's suppliers) but can't release THAT source on. They're free to release on any AMD code, or read the drivers to find out what they actually do (and then re-implement it as free code).

Cheers,
Wol

Copyright © 2013, Eklektix, Inc.
Comments and public postings are copyrighted by their creators.
Linux is a registered trademark of Linus Torvalds